SF Giants 2012

March 14, 2012 8:36 pm

Everyone seems to have forgotten about our injuries last year. If we stay healthy, we should win around 95 games next year. Before you right me off, let me explain. At one time last year we could have filled an entire lineup card with players on the DL with the names like Posey, Sanchez, Schierholtz, and even Sandoval. The Giants are coming off a horrible year of injuries that no doubtly deserve the blame for our fall last year. So for all of you who insist on saying we will fall short this year because of Sabeans lack of free agent signing, you need to stop and think about health. 

*My unprofessional projections* 

-Lineup for 2012- 

Cabrera .270-.280 30-40SB which is a huge improvment from Torres' numbers of last year. (.220 4HR) 

F. Sanchez .290-.310 25-30SB 

Posey .290-.310 25-30HR 

Sandoval .290-.310 30-35HR 

Schierholtz .270-.280 18-22HR 

Belt .270-.280 18-22HR if not better 

Crawford obvious hitting issues,.220-.240, but makes up for it with great defense at short Pagan Poor hitting, .220-.240 but typical number 8 hitting numbers. 

 

 

Look for a breakout year from Belt.
